Table 1.

Description of C. elegans – human orthologs. The Swiss-Prot accession numbers are given for the worm sequences and their human orthologs. TM: the number of transmembrane regions predicted using the consensus of nine different methods in the SFINX tool. Bootstrap support (%) is given for the inferred speciation node in the phylogenetic tree constructed using PHYLOWIN with PAM distances. Identity (%): sequence percentage identity from the Blastp output between the C. elegans gene and the nearest human ortholog. Four of the worm genes are predicted to have two splice variants (a and b). However, there are only small differences in the protein sequences between the two variants, except for R155.1. Splice variant R155.1b is predicted to have a truncation of more than one hundred amino acids in the N-terminus compared to R155.1a. The PF03062 domain (MBOAT) is still present in both splice variants. The protein sequence for R155.1a was used in the phylogenetic analysis.

1 T28F3.3 was initially included because of strong similarity to Q92504; however, the phylogenetic analysis showed that it is probably an outparalog to the human gene.

2 ER = endoplasmic reticulum.

* predicted to have a N-terminal signal peptide.
